Why Developers Look To Bode.
Development requires more than an attractive floor plan. It requires repeatability, scope clarity, material coordination and a system that can respond to site conditions. Bode separates performance from completion scope, allowing the project team to select the right envelope/engineering pathway and then determine how much material integration Bode should provide.
A community can use a disciplined family of models, elevations, exterior materials and Interior Collections to create visual variety while retaining the efficiencies of a repeatable system. The objective is not rows of identical units. It is controlled variation built on a common platform.

What Bode Does & What The Project Team Does.
Bode provides the engineered construction kit and the materials included in the selected package. The developer’s project team remains responsible for land, planning/entitlements, site design, civil work, utilities, foundations/site work, local permits, construction labour, trades and other items unless expressly included in a written Bode scope. This division of responsibility should be established early.
The fastest way to determine fit is to begin with the site and business plan: location, land status, intended use, approximate unit count, preferred models or unit mix, target customer/tenant, performance objectives, desired completion scope, budget framework and target schedule.
